Packages in non-free can be autobuilt

2020-12-19 Thread Adrian Bunk
Looking at the cluster3 discussion, just a reminder that many packages in non-free can be autobuilt just like packages in main: https://www.debian.org/doc/manuals/developers-reference/pkgs.en.html#marking-non-free-packages-as-auto-buildable This is also already happening for Debian Med packages:
